Student Design Competition
Since 2013, the BC Water & Waste Association (BCWWA) has hosted an annual design competition for postsecondary students in British Columbia. This competition aims to help students apply their academic skills to solve real-world water and wastewater problems we face every day, develop leadership and communication skills and innovate the water sector.
The winning teams from BC have gone on to compete internationally at the Water Environment Federation’s Technical Exhibition and Conference (WEFTEC) against teams from across Canada, the United States and the world.

2026 competition Winners
In March 2026, Team BioWise Solutions from the British Columbia Institute of Technology (BCIT) was named the winner of the 2026 BCWWA Student Design Competition. The team is comprised of: Gianmarco Urbano(Lead), Prabhkirat Singh, Brian Castillo, Alexander Reis and Benjamin Mendoza.
Their winning presentation found innovative ways to balance green and gray infrastructure to create a more resilient community at the Fishtrap Creek Watershed in the City of Abbotsford.
Team BioWise Solutions accepted an award at the 2026 BCWWA Annual Conference & Trade Show and will go on to compete at the 2026 WEFTEC Student Design Competition. Both events provide excellent exposure to potential industry employers.
